Purepoint Uranium to advance exploration at prospective Athabasca Basin projects

Source:Small Caps

Toronto-based Purepoint Uranium Group (TSX-V: PTU) has outlined ambitious exploration plans for the remainder of the year at its suite of 10 wholly-owned projects and one joint venture asset in Canada's prolific Athabasca Basin. The program of work includes follow-up drilling at some of the company's high-priority targets, inaugural drilling at more advanced prospects and initial geophysical work over earlier stage properties.

Purepoint president and chief executive officer Chris Frostad said the company was keen to return to the Red Willow project where a winter drilling campaign identified a continuous corridor of elevated radioactivity associated with the Osprey Zone electromagnetic conduc- tor. A total of 12 holes for 2,088 metres encountered anomalous radioactivity at a shallow depth from surface across a distance of 1.2 kilometres.

"Moving the drill with large 300-metrestep-outs, we were able to determine that the northern portion of this conductor was subject to an area-wide mineralisation event resulting in the potential for significant uranium deposition," Mr Frostad explained. "The discovery of a clearly-defined continuous zone of radioactivity extending across such a long distance with peaks exceeding 33,000 counts per second, provides an exciting preview of what our next program may demonstrate."

Red Willow drilling: Drilling at Red Willow will resume in September to follow-up on the final hole of the winter program, which encountered numerous structures, with hematite alteration and silicification representing a highly prospective setting for uranium deposition. Red Willow is situated on the northern edge of the eastern Athabasca Basin mine corridor in northern Saskatchewan. The property is located close to several uranium deposits including Orano Canada's McLean Lake operation, approximately 10km to the southwest, and Cameco Corporation's Eagle Point mine, 10km to the south.

Flagship project: In June, Purepoint plans to conduct a deep-sensing ZTEM airborne geophysical survey over its flagship Hook Lake project in the Patterson district to further refine drill targets in anticipation of a follow-up drill program. Considered to be the most prospective exploration project in Athabasca Basin, Hook Lake is a joint venture between Cameco, Orano and Purepoint and has been operated by Purepoint since 2007.

Purepoint said it would also run an airborne gravity survey next month over the Carson Lake and Russell South projects, where significant preliminary work has already been completed.

Richest uranium jurisdiction: The Athabasca Basin is the world's richest uranium jurisdiction which is host to several of the highest-grade uranium deposits on the planet. Spanning close to 100,000sq km across Saskatchewan and Alberta, the basin is a major contributor to Canada's status as the world's second largest uranium producer and the third largest holder of uranium reserves. The region is home to the world's largest uranium mine at Cigar Lake (owned by Cameco), which reports average grades of 14.69% uranium oxide and accounts for 13% of global uranium production.

Aggressive approach: Purepoint is focused on advancing properties with well-defined targets of strong, high-grade uranium potential, driven by an aggressive, systematic approach of identifying key projects with solid indicators and historical significance in the basin. Since 2002, the company has acquired and explored over 5000sq km of property across Athabas- ca, and quickly released those which have demonstrated the fewest prospects.

The company has been left with a collection of well-understood projects containing dozens of clearly defined, uranium-bearing targets which have been safely maintained to maximise their value during the current uranium price revival. ●

Red Willow Project

The 100% owned Red Willow property is situated on the northern edge of the eastern Athabasca Basin mine corridor in Northern Saskatch- ewan, Canada. The property is located in close proximity to several uranium deposits including Orano Resources Canada Inc.'s JEB mine, approximately 10 kilometres to the southwest, and Cameco's Eagle Point mine that is approximately 10 kilometres due south.

Red Willow consists of 17 mineral claims having a total area of 40,116 hectares. Geophysical surveys conducted by Purepoint have included airborne magnetic and EM surveys, an airborne radiometric survey, ground gradient array IP, pole-dipole array IP, fixed-loop and moving -loop transient electromagnetics, and gravity. The detailed airborne VTEM survey provided magnetic results that are an excellent base on which to interpret structures while the EM results outlined over 70 kilometres of conductors that in most instances represent favourable graphitic lithology.

Turnor Lake Project

Turnor Lake is most notably associated with the Kelsey Dome Granite, a pinwheel shaped magnetic high encircled with clusters of graphitic conductors and numerous high-grade uranium showings. The La Rocque Uranium Corridor bisects the northern portion of the project area and lies along the western edge of the Kelsey Dome Formation.

Extensive geophysical programs have allowed Purepoint to outline approximately 34 kilometres of conductors throughout the Turnor Lake Project. Most recently, Purepoint created a 3D lithological model from interpreted cross-sections, drill hole information and surface/bed- rock geology. Geophysical data was added in tight integration with the geological model and newly created geophysical inversions, allowing the geophysical data to be represented by a 3D distribution of physical rock properties. Using GOCAD Mining suite Targeting Workflow by Mira Geoscience, the geological, geochemical and geophysical datasets were then integrated and the exploration drill targets were refined.

The Serin conductor is interpreted to be the northeastern extension of the conductor system which hosts Cameco Corp's high grade uranium mineralization at La Rocque Lake (29.9% U3O8 over 7.0 m in hole Q22-40) and IsoEnergy Ltd.'s Laroque East project which hosts their recently discovered high-grade Hurricane Zone (38.8% U3O8 over 7.5 m in hole LE20-76). Serin is a near-vertical conductor extending northeast-southwest for at least 2.2 km and is interpreted to lie at a shallow depth of 400 to 450m below surface.

Results from EM surveys conducted by Purepoint suggest the conductor is vertically offset by approximately 150 metres at the same location that a seismic survey, conducted by Saskatchewan Energy and Mines in 1984, reflects a significant down drop in the basement topography. The MacArthur River Deposit, one of the world's largest uranium mines, was formed at the site of a similar basement step-fault that likely focused mineralized fluids.

Hook Lake - The Carter Corridor

The Hook Lake JV Project is owned jointly by Cameco Corp. (39.5%), Orano Canada Inc. (39.5%) and Purepoint Uranium Group Inc. (21%) as operator and consists of nine claims totaling 28,598 hectares situated in the southwestern Athabasca Basin. The Hook Lake JV Project is considered one of the highest quality uranium exploration projects in the Athabasca Basin due to its location along the prospective Patter- son Lake trend and the relatively shallow depth to the unconformity.

The 25-kilometre strike length of the Carter structural/conductive corridor is almost entirely located within the Hook Lake JV project. The Carter corridor is a long lived, reactivated fault zone that lies between the Clearwater Domain granitic intrusives to the west and runs parallel to the Patterson structural corridor to the immediate east.

The Patterson Lake area was recently flown by an airborne gravity survey (Boulanger, Kiss and Tschirhart, 2019) that was funded by the Targeted Geoscience Initiative (TGI), a collaborative federal geoscience program. The gravity results show the southern portion of the Carter corridor as being associated with the same gravity high response as the Triple R and Arrow uranium deposits. The gravity low response west of the Carter corridor reflects the geologically younger, Clearwater Domain intrusions. The TGI (Potter et al., 2020) consider the Clearwater Domain intrusions as being high-heat-producers that warmed and circulated hydrothermal fluids over the structural corridors. Prolonged interaction of oxidized uranium-bearing fluids with basement rocks via reactivated faults is thought to have formed the high-grade uranium deposits.

Purepoint completed three drill holes in the southern portion of the Carter corridor (HK08-01 to 03) during 2008. HK08-01 intersected very strong sericite and silica hydrothermal alteration) and returned a maximum of 17 ppm U within basement rock but missed the conductor source. HK08-02 returned locally elevated radioactivity from 20 to 30 metres below the unconformity while HK08-03 intersected 60 metres of intense hydrothermal hematite alteration below the unconformity.

Carson Lake Project

The 100% owned, 4,972 hectare, Carson Lake Project adjoins ValOre Metals Hatchet Lake Project on the north-eastern edge of the Atha- basca Basin. The project covers a historic airborne geophysical EM survey that outlined a strong northeast trending conductor approximately 10 kilometres in length. The survey presents two primary target areas.

To the north, the Killock target is presumed to be graphitic pelite that has been incorporated into the north-south trending Killock Fault. Brittle structures such as the Killock fault intersecting ductile rock types, such as graphitic pelite, can create favourable dilation zones and allow uranium-rich fluids to become trapped.

The Lejour target is located where the north-south trending Lejour Fault crosscuts the main conductor. The recent interpretation of the EW data by Purepoint indicates that the single conductor west of the Lejour Fault is present as two parallel conductors south of the fault.

Russell South Project

The 100% owned Russell Lake Project is located near the south-central edge of the Athabasca Basin covering an area of 13,320 hectares. The project adjoins Cameco's Key Lake project on which the Key Lake Mine produced over 200 million pounds of uranium at a grade averaging 2.3% U3O8 between 1983 and 1997. In addition, the project adjoins the Moore Lake Project owned by Skyharbour Resources Ltd. with their high-grade Maverick Zone and Rio Tinto's Russell Lake Project to the west and south.

Forum announced that an extensive resistivity survey has commenced on the Fir Island Uranium project under option to Orano Canada Inc. Orano is funding this $495,000 survey as part of its option to earn up to 70% of the Fir Island project by spending up to $6 million. Orano has funded two drill programs with Forum as Operator and upon completion of this program, Orano will have spent $3 million on the project to earn a 51% interest.

Approximately 25 lines, spaced 200m apart, will be completed for the survey by Patterson Geophysics of La Ronge, SK. The program should take 4 to 6 weeks to complete.
